What's more important?...
To make more money, or save more money?
This is the question I like to ask my prospects before we even start talking about the details. The follow up questions are "why? What would you use the money for?"
By asking this simple question, you get your prospects thinking about why they would want to take on something new. When exposed to your information, they are typically going to be thinking if they can do it and if it would be worth their time. If you expose their why ahead of time, they can answer those questions for themselves. After all, we have our own reasons for doing what we do.
When you first considered the thought of starting your journey down the road of network marketing, you most likely had a reason why you decided to join your respective company. I know I started in mine with the dream of getting my life back. I wanted to stop trading my time for money and start trading it for freedom.
In order to reach your goals, it's so important to remember your personal why. Write it down and put it up on your wall. Display it proudly! When times get rough, look at that at it will help push you through. A dream board is another great idea that can help us all stay focused on the prize. Clip pictures of the car of your dreams, the house of your dreams, whatever stirs your ambitions.
Recently I went through an exercise with my team and asked them to quickly write down 25 things they are going to get when they promote to the top level in the organization. Aim high I told them. See by telling them to think of 25 things they will get when they reach their goal, they thought of things they wouldn't have normally. It put them in the right mindset.
Try it with your own teams. You will be amazed at some of the things they will think of. They can then go back once in a while and look at those items. They are also reasons why they are working the business.
Anything we can do to help maintain the mindset we need to keep driving forward and push ourselves is a good thing. Go out of your comfort zone, focus on your why and good things will happen.
